java mybatis-puls 查询出一个列表按createTime创建时间顺序排序怎么写
时间: 2024-02-09 15:10:19 浏览: 68
你可以使用MyBatis-Plus的QueryWrapper来实现按照createTime创建时间顺序排序,具体代码可以参考以下示例:
```
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Service;
import java.util.List;
@Service
public class UserService {
@Autowired
private UserMapper userMapper;
public List<User> getUserList() {
QueryWrapper<User> wrapper = new QueryWrapper<>();
wrapper.orderByAsc("create_time");
return userMapper.selectList(wrapper);
}
}
```
其中,`QueryWrapper`是MyBatis-Plus提供的一个查询条件构造器,`orderByAsc`方法用于指定按照`create_time`字段顺序排序。最后,调用`selectList`方法执行查询并返回结果列表。
阅读全文